Event description

EMPLOYEE KILLED WHEN STRUCK BY FALLING PIPES

Investigation abstract

At a marine terminal aboard the vessel "Lydia", Employee #1 was assigned to unlo ad pipe out of hatch #2. The load of 40 ft long pipe was being hoisted out of th e hatch by a crane when the load hit the pontoon hatch cover. This caused the tw o slings (one on each end of the load of pipe) to slide and come together causin g the pipes to dislodge and fall back into the hold. Employees inside of the hol d scattered to avoid the falling load. Employee #1 was struck and killed by a le ngth of pipe.
